
Set within lush rainforest and natural hot springs, Poring is a favourite stop for travellers seeking relaxation and nature in one place. From soaking in geothermal pools to tackling the Poring Hot Spring canopy walk, there’s no shortage of things to do in Poring Hot Spring, whether you’re here for a quick visit or a longer jungle escape.
With a range of lodges and hostels available, booking a stay at Poring Hot Springs lets you remain right inside the reserve and enjoy early mornings, quiet evenings, and easy access to the park’s trails and pools.

Ishan from the United Kingdom on a 2-night couple stay at Kelicap Twin Share
“Ecologically friendly, close to nature. Just inside Poring Hot Spring park, worth staying for a night or two. If you feel up for it, definitely visit Langanam waterfalls, it’s a long and sometimes steep walk but the forest and waterfall are both easily worth it. I saw a wild orangutan moving through the treetops! Ask at reception to pre-book a massage in your room after a day hiking or swimming.”
